Seafood

Vaugirard/Grenelle, Paris, France

5 places near Vaugirard/Grenelle (Paris), ordered by rating:

5.0
1 review
Telephone:
+33 9 51 29 16 92
Address:
32 rue des Volontaires
4.3
8 reviews
Telephone:
+33 1 44 26 10 77
Address:
19 Avenue Félix Faure
4.0
2 reviews
Telephone:
+33 1 40 60 65 65
Address:
2 rue Mademoiselle
4.0
21 reviews
Telephone:
+33 1 45 32 94 05
Address:
2 bis rue Petel
Kyo
···
Telephone:
+33 9 54 21 91 36
Address:
44 rue de Lourmel